When enquiring, ask about the age groups and activity tracks on offer, whether the programme runs full-day or half-day, and which school holiday periods are covered. Clarify whether enrolment is per-week or for the full camp duration, what the group size and supervisor ratio look like, and whether any trial or single-day option is available before committing to a longer block. It is also worth confirming what is included in the fee — meals, materials, and excursions can vary between programmes — and whether a sibling discount applies.

Holiday camp fees are typically structured as weekly or per-programme packages rather than individual per-session rates. Costs vary depending on the duration (half-day vs full-day), the activity track, and whether meals or materials are included. In the Singapore market, multi-day holiday camp programmes generally range from S$300 to S$900 per week depending on the provider and activities offered. It is worth asking whether a sibling discount or early-bird rate applies, and confirming exactly what is covered in the fee before enrolling. See the full holiday camps cost guide for Singapore →

When assessing fit, look at whether the activity level and structure suit your child's age and interests, whether the group size feels appropriate, and whether the supervisory ratio and daily routine are clearly communicated during the sign-up process.
Camp Beaumont is an established holiday camp operator with programmes typically delivered by trained activity leaders and coaches, though specific instructor qualifications will vary by activity track. It is advisable to ask the provider directly about the background and experience of the staff running the particular programme your child would attend, and whether any specialist coaches (for example, sports, arts, or STEM) are involved. If the camp is hosted on the Nexus International School campus, ask whether any school staff or facilities are involved, and confirm the supervision ratio for your child's age group before committing.
